Real Line
A linear continuum of points representing real numbers, effectively illustrating the concept of the infinite nature of real numbers on a one-dimensional scale.
Inequality
A mathematical expression that shows the relationship between two values that are not equal, using symbols such as <, >, ≤, or ≥.
